NE 40th sidewalk repair expands scope; staff to remove 49 street trees and propose mitigation
Summary
Staff briefed council on an expanded Northeast 40th Street sidewalk repair project (156th Avenue to Belle Red Road) that will remove 49 street trees after design changes to maintain an ADA‑compliant route; project will pay approximately $31,000 to the city's tree mitigation fund and staff will return bid results and the proposed contract for Nov. 4 new business.
City staff outlined changes to the Northeast 40th Street sidewalk repair project and said the scope expansion is intended to deliver a continuous ADA‑compliant route to transit.
